WebJan 31, 2024 · The checks require landlords and lettings agents operating in England to determine the immigration status of all prospective adult tenants by checking ID before the start of a tenancy. Checks do not need to be carried out on tenants in Wales, Scotland or Northern Ireland. COVID adjusted checks WebWhat is a Right to Rent check? This is when a prospective adult occupant of a rental property shows their identity documents in person to a landlord or letting agent. This is a similar checking process to presenting your passport (and visa) to a border control officer at an immigration check point.

WebAug 2, 2024 · Your share code is a 9-digit number that allows your landlord to look up your right to rent.
